@charset "utf-8";
/* CSS Document */

* {margin:0; padding:0;}
img {border:0;}
ul {list-style:none; display:block;}
body {font-weight:normal; font-size:12px; color:#808282; background:#a6d0e6 url(../images/bg.jpg) left top repeat-x; font-family:Arial, Helvetica, sans-serif;}
h1, h2, h3, h4, h5, h6 {font-weight:normal;}

h1 {font-size:24px; color:#8a8a8a;}

a {color:#696969; text-decoration:none;}
a:hover {color:#23538a; text-decoration:underline;}


#wrapper {width:1012px; margin:0 auto;}
#header {width:100%; float:left; height:401px;}
.logo {width:312px; float:left; margin-top:37px; margin-left:20px; margin-bottom:14px;}
.nav {width:574px; float:left;background:url(../images/navbg.jpg) left top no-repeat; margin-top:95px; height:37px; padding-top:9px; font-size:18px; padding-left:55px;}
.nav ul { height:30px; }
.nav li {display:block; width:auto; float:left; height:30px; border-right:1px solid #FFFFFF;}
.bd0 {border:0 !important;}
.nav .selected {text-decoration:underline; color:#fff331;}
.nav li a {display:block; float:left; color:#FFFFFF; text-decoration:none; padding:0 17px;}
.nav li a:hover {text-decoration:underline; color:#fff331;}

.banner {width:869px; float:left; background:url(../images/paintbox.jpg) left top no-repeat; padding:119px 0 0 143px; height:116px;}

.learn {width:113px; height:26px;}
.learn a {display:block; text-align:center; line-height:26px; text-decoration:underline; color:#FFFFFF; background:url(../images/learn.jpg) left top no-repeat;}
.learn a:hover {background:url(../images/learn.jpg) left -26px no-repeat;}

#bodyarea {width:100%; float:left;}

.aboutamar {width:100%; float:left; background:#cbcebf url(../images/amarind.jpg) right top no-repeat; padding-top:19px;}

.creambox {width:561px; float:left; margin:0 20px; margin-bottom:14px;}
.creamboxtop {width:561px; float:left; height:16px; background:url(../images/creamboxtop.jpg) left top no-repeat;}
.creamboxcont {width:527px; float:left; background:#dbdacc; padding:0 17px;}
.creamboxbot {width:561px; float:left; height:16px; background:url(../images/creamboxbot.jpg) left top no-repeat;}
.creamboxcont h1 {margin-bottom:10px;}
.creamboxcont p {line-height:17px;}

.news {width:395px; float:left; padding:39px 0 0 16px;}
.wau {width:auto;}
.fl {float:left;}
.fr {float:right;}
.tal {text-align:left;}
.tac {text-align:center;}
.tar {text-align:right;}
.w100 {width:100%;}

.smalltext {font-size:11px; color:#FFFFFF; margin-left:65px; margin-bottom:20px; float:left; width:auto;}
.input {background:url(../images/inputbg.jpg) left top no-repeat; width:97px; height:18px; padding:7px 5px; color:#7cabb6; border:0; float:left;}
.mr4 {margin-right:4px;}
.mb62 {margin-bottom:62px;}
.input2 {background:url(../images/inputbgbigger.jpg); width:210px; height:15px; padding:7px 5px; color:#7cabb6; border:0; float:left;}
.producttop {width:992px; float:left; height:33px; background:#dedede url(../images/rightcut.jpg) right top no-repeat; padding-left:20px; padding-top:9px;}
.producttop2 {width:992px; float:left; height:33px; background:#dedede url(../images/rightcut2.jpg) right top no-repeat; padding-left:20px; padding-top:9px;}
.producttopsmall {width:992px; float:left; height:24px; background:#dedede url(../images/rightcutsmall.jpg) right top no-repeat; padding-left:20px; padding-top:9px;}
.proarea {width:992px; float:left; background:url(../images/probg.jpg) left top repeat-y; padding-left:20px; padding-top:19px;}
.proarea img {margin:0 21px 17px 0;}
.bottom  { width:920px; float:left; background:url(../images/bottom-top.png) left top no-repeat; padding:20px 62px 0 30px; text-align:center; height:69px;}
.bottom  a {padding:0 5px;}
.ft18 {font-size:18px;}
.ft20 {font-size:20px;}
.ft10 {font-size:10px;}
.ft18 {font-size:18px;}
.ft22 {font-size:22px;}
.ft24 {font-size:24px;}
.ft14 {font-size:14px;}

#footer {width:1012px; float:left; background:url(../images/bottom-fot.png) 19px top no-repeat; padding:; margin-bottom:100px; color:#696969; text-align:center; height:110px; padding:20px 0 0 0;}

#footer a {text-decoration:underline;}
#footer a:hover {text-decoration:none;}

.proarea2 {width:912px; float:left; background:url(../images/probg.jpg) left top repeat-y; padding-left:20px; padding-right:80px; line-height:16px; padding-bottom:20px;}
.proarea3 {width:912px; float:left; background:url(../images/probg.jpg) left top repeat-y; padding-left:20px; padding-right:80px; line-height:16px; padding-bottom:20px;}

.proarea2 p {width:100%; float:left; color:#606060; margin-bottom:15px;}

.pt14 {padding-top:14px !important;}

.cnform {width:448px; margin:0 auto;}  

.cnform dl {width:100%; float:left; margin-top:20px;  color:#8a8a8a; font-weight:bold; font-size:14px;}
.cnform dd {width:128px; float:left; margin-bottom:10px; display:block; padding-top:3px;}
.cnform dt {width:320px; float:left; display:block; display:block; margin-bottom:10px;}
.cnform dt textarea {width:310px; height:101px; background:url(../images/txtar.jpg) left top no-repeat; border:0; color:#d65d31; font-weight:bold; padding:5px;}
.cnform dt input[type=submit]:hover {background:url(../images/submit.jpg) left -29px no-repeat; border:0; cursor:pointer;}
.cnform dt p {margin-bottom:5px; float:left; width:100%;}

.cnform2 {width:348px; margin-left:20px;}  

.cnform2 dl {width:100%; float:left; margin-top:20px;  color:#8a8a8a; font-weight:bold; font-size:14px;}
.cnform2 dd {width:128px; float:left; margin-bottom:10px; display:block; padding-top:3px;}
.cnform2 dt {width:220px; float:left; display:block; margin-bottom:10px;}
.cnform2 dt textarea {width:210px; height:101px; background:url(../images/txtar2.jpg) left top no-repeat; border:0; color:#d65d31; font-weight:bold; padding:5px;}
.cnform2 dt input[type=submit]:hover {background:url(../images/submit.jpg) left -29px no-repeat; border:0; cursor:pointer;}
.cnform2 dt p {margin-bottom:5px; float:left; width:100%;}

.inp {width:310px; height:19px; background:url(../images/input2.jpg) left top no-repeat; padding:5px; border:0;  color:#d65d31; font-weight:bold; font-size:13px;}

.inp2 {width:210px; height:19px; background:url(../images/input3.jpg) left top no-repeat; padding:5px; border:0;  color:#d65d31; font-weight:bold; font-size:13px;}

.sub {width:84px; height:29px; background:url(../images/submit.jpg) left top no-repeat; border:0;}

.address {width:349px; float:right; margin-right:28px;}
.addresstop {width:259px; float:left; background:url(../images/address.png) left top no-repeat; font-size:16px; color:#8a8a8a; min-height:250px; padding:45px 30px 0 60px;}  
.addresstop p {line-height:21px; font-weight:bold;}
.addressbot {width:349px; float:left; background:url(../images/address.png) left bottom no-repeat; height:15px;}

.boxcream {width:923px; float:left; margin-bottom:20px;}
.boxcreamtop {width:923px; height:15px; background:url(../images/boxcreamtop.jpg) left top no-repeat;}
.boxcreamcont {width:883px; background:#efeeee; padding:0 20px; float:left;}
.boxcreambot {width:923px; height:15px; background:url(../images/boxcreambot.jpg) left top no-repeat; float:left;}

.boxcreamcont h3 {font-size:15px; font-weight:bold; color:#426a98; margin-bottom:10px;}
.boxcreamcont p {float:left; width:100%;  color:#5d5c5c;}
.boxcreamcont ul {float:left; width:80%; margin-left:30px;  color:#5d5c5c; list-style:disc; margin-top:5px; margin-bottom:15px;}

.boxcreamcont2 {width:883px; background:#efeeee; padding:0 20px; float:left;}
.boxcreamcont2 h3 {font-size:15px; font-weight:bold; color:#426a98; margin-bottom:10px;}
.boxcreamcont2 p {float:left; width:100%;  color:#5d5c5c;}

.mb20 {margin-bottom:20px;}

.slidesmall {width:277px; height:355px; float:left; margin-right:20px;}
.slidesmall ul {list-style:none; width:100%; float:left;}
.slidesmall li {width:100%; display:block;}

.sltxt {width:586px; float:left;}
.sltxt h3 {width:100%; float:left; font-size:15px; font-weight:bold; color:#426a98; margin-bottom:10px;}
.sltxt p {float:left; width:100%;  color:#5d5c5c;}

.sltxt ul {float:left; list-style-type:disc; width:550px; margin-left:36px;} 



.req {width:133px; height:32px; float:left; padding-left:433px;}
.req a {display:block; text-decoration:none; width:133px; height:32px; background:url(../images/req.jpg) left top no-repeat; text-indent:-9999px;}
.req a:hover {background:url(../images/req.jpg) left -32px no-repeat;}

.qcont {width:655px; float:left; background:#FFFFFF; padding:0 20px;}
.qcont h1 {margin-bottom:20px; float:left; width:100%;}
.toptxt {width:100%; float:left;  color:#535758;}

.clred {color:#FF0000;}

.txtile {width:100%; float:left;}
.toptextile {height:36px; color:#FFFFFF;}

.txtaar {width:680px; float:left; overflow:auto;}

.pleasttxt {font-size:14px; font-weight:bold; color:#555353;}
.pl10 {padding-left:10px;}
.tabinp {width:158px; padding:3px; font-size:12px; color:#333333; font-weight:bold;}
.wd30 {width:90px;}
.txttabar {font-size:11px; font-weight:normal;}
.pd5 {padding:5px;}
.txtar {border:1px solid #999898; border-top:none; padding:10px; width:633px; float:left;}
.txtar2 {border:1px solid #999898; border-top:none; padding:10px; width:533px; float:left;}

.txt633 {width:613px; height:145px; padding:5px 10px;   color:#d65d31; font-weight:bold; background:url(../images/txtar558.jpg) left top no-repeat; border:0;}
.txtcnt {width:655px; float:left; background:#24548b; height:30px; font-size:14px; text-align:center; color:#FFFFFF; line-height:30px;}

.mb5 {margin-bottom:5px;}
.plds {width:643px; float:left; border:1px solid #999898; border-top:none; height:30px; line-height:30px; color:#8a8a8a; padding-left:10px;}
.plds2 {width:643px; float:left; border:1px solid #999898;  border-top:none; height:55px; line-height:50px; color:#8a8a8a; padding-left:10px;}

.table {width:655px; float:left; font-weight:bold;}
.table  ul {list-style:none; float:left;}
.bcl1 {width:138px;} 
.bcl1 li {border:1px solid #999898; border-top:none; width:126px; float:left; min-height:30px; line-height:30px; padding-left:10px;}
.bcl2 {width:210px;}
.bcl2 li {width:199px; float:left; min-height:30px; border-right:1px solid #999898; border-bottom:1px solid #999898; padding:0 5px;}
.bcl2 select {width:191px; height:27px; padding:5px 3px 3px; background:url(../images/inp190bg.jpg) left top no-repeat; border:0;}
.bcl2 p {width:57px; float:left; font-size:10px; margin-bottom:8px;}
.bcl3 {width:97px;}
.bcl3 li {width:87px; float:left; min-height:30px; border-right:1px solid #999898; border-bottom:1px solid #999898; padding:0 5px; line-height:30px;}


.inptab {width:190px; height:24px; padding:3px 3px 0; background:url(../images/inp190bg.jpg) left top no-repeat; border:0; margin-top:1px;}
.inptab2 {width:46px; height:24px; padding:3px 3px 0; background:url(../images/inp52.jpg) left top no-repeat; border:0; margin-top:1px;}
.inptab3 {width:79px; height:24px; padding:3px 3px 0; background:url(../images/inp85.jpg) left top no-repeat; border:0; margin-top:1px;}

.wd85 {width:85px !important;}
.mb0 {margin-bottom:0 !important;}
.mr6 {margin-right:6px;}
.hg60 {height:60px !important;}

.qcontainer {width:695px; margin:0 auto;}
.whttop {width:695px; float:left; height:20px; background:url(../images/whttop.jpg) left top no-repeat;}
.whtbot {width:695px; float:left; height:20px; background:url(../images/whtbot.jpg) left top no-repeat;}

.lh0 {line-height:normal !important;}
